RFID Transponders, Tags
RFID (Radiofrequency Identification) is a technology consisting of active and passive tags, transponders, readers, and antennas that allow for the identification of objects in an automated fashion. It is used in an ever-increasing range of applications, such as, access control, asset tracking, medical ID, arts and museum identification, CBM applications, and general track & trace use cases. The active tag is also sometimes known as a transponder. An active tag incorporates a battery of its own, allowing the RFID device to actively transmit back a signal, without the need for a powered reader. Active tags usually broadcast in the ‘milliwatt’ power range, up to 10 watts, or more as needed. These tags are typically used as beacons that can be used to alert personnel when passing through a specific area.The most common example of an RFID tag is a passive tag. This type of tag does not contain any active components such as a battery and is powered by the RFID reader when the tag is within its vicinity. When the RFID reader pings the passive tag, the tag receives the energy and broadcasts its unique ID and other data back to the reader.
